WebDec 13, 2024 · CIPD assignment requires the use of the Harvard style of referencing. Therefore, it is essential that you get familiar with this style early enough to reduce your load in the later stages of writing your assignment. The majority of CIPD courses use the Harvard referencing style - see our guide on How to set out references [link].

WebNov 21, 2024 · At Intermediate Level it is a requirement of the CIPD that 3-5 research pieces are provided per assignment and you must make sure that you clearly acknowledge where you have used them. You need to do this by placing within the report where they have supported your findings, as well as on a reference list.

A reference includes additional details about each source referenced. This enables the reader to refer to the original source, should they need to. The reference list is a detailed list of all the works consulted while writing.
